Задача. Нека е дадена следната програма

pow x y = x ^ y

 

mySum x y = x + y

 

pow2 = pow 2

 

sum10 = mySum 10

 Какво представляват стойностите на pow2 и sum10? Какво можем да правим с тях?

 

Задача. Да се построи списък от функции. Какво можем да правим с този списък? Да се извлече вторият елемент на списъка и да се приложи върху някакви аргументи.

 

Задача. Да се дефинира функция valuesOf l x, която по списък от едноместни функции и даден параметър, намира списъка от стойностите на тези функции върху параметъра.

 

Задача. Да се дефинира функция maxValues l x, която по непразен списък от едноместни числови функции намира най-голямата от стойностите на функциите върху дадения параметър.

 

Задача. Да се дефинира функция maxFunction l x, която по непразен списък от функции намира тази от тях, имаща най-голяма стойност върху дадения параметър.

Last modified: Saturday, 12 November 2011, 5:38 PM